Gibson Flying V Jimi Hendrix Murphy Lab (2020)

This model recreates the Flying V that Gibson designed for Jimi Hendrix in the late 1960s, a project that was never released due to Hendrix’s death. Its construction combines a mahogany body and neck with a narrow, 60s-style Slim Taper profile and an ebony fretboard.

Among its details are the split-diamond mother-of-pearl inlays, medium jumbo frets, and two Gibson Custombucker pickups that deliver a classic and versatile tone. The hardware includes an ABR-1 bridge with nylon saddles and a Maestro Short Vibrola tailpiece, elements that reinforce its vintage character.

The guitar features a handcrafted relicing process performed by Gibson’s Murphy Lab, which accurately reproduces the natural wear and tear of the era. Even its hardshell case was recreated following the original patterns, with fabrics identical to those used in Hendrix’s outfits, in floral designs and pastel colors.
